Optimum sample size for determining disease severity and defoliation associated with Septoria leaf spot of blueberry
In a 3-year field study, Premier rabbiteye blueberry plants were sampled at three hierarchical levels (leaf, shoot, and bush) to assess severity of Septoria leaf spot (caused by Septoria al- bopunctata) and incidence of defoliation.
